A better deal for children?

NCOSS News

Author: Voigt, L., Dodds, I., Ruchel, J., Frow, L., Moore, G.
Year: 1997
Type: Journal Article

Abstract:

The Department of Community Services has released a major discussion paper and a summary of key issues in relation to the Children (Care and Protection) Act. In this article NCOSS members highlight areas that require additional examination, such as whether children should be protected against discrimination and whether assistance from the state should be monitored against standards. The authors also state that services for children need to comply with quality standards and be monitored by an independent body. The report provides some discussion of disability issues, with more comment needed on areas such as: accommodation alternatives; interagency cooperation; detection, notification and interviewing; and the impact of disability upon families with regard to child protection.
